The Selected Poems of Harriet Monroe
About this book
The Selected Poems of Harriet Monroe, Volume 1, presents a comprehensive collection of work from the founding editor of Poetry magazine. This literary volume highlights Monroe as a prolific Modernist poet from the Midwest, moving beyond her role as an editor to showcase her own poetic talent. The text spans a period of global upheaval, covering the American Civil War, World War I, and the Great Depression.
This work of history and criticism incorporates previously unpublished poems and long out-of-print pieces. The content explores themes of gender, motherhood, and environmental conservation, alongside critiques of industrialization and war. Through a blend of love lyrics and meditations on globalization, this volume of literature and fiction establishes Monroe as a vital voice in American poetry. The collection includes a critical introduction and explanatory notes to provide deeper context for the poems.
